Transaction 97911332cba29306aa4cfecab96a026b355c6f2f4b813a72c8129a8fbcb25dea

2 Input
2 Outputs
  • 97911332cba29306aa4cfecab96a026b355c6f2f4b813a72c8129a8fbcb25dea:0
  • value  1502968
    address  3EgC5SpPDfdU8ibWh7Py9SKgPydRZYHCML
  • 97911332cba29306aa4cfecab96a026b355c6f2f4b813a72c8129a8fbcb25dea:1
  • value  1000000
    address  385poWYZGf3BTn2ZvwsD7HmZVR16CkTgx1